Some of you might not be aware that for the 7th inning stretch at Chicago Cubs home games, it's a tradition started by WGN television play by play announcer Harry Caray to sing "Take Me Out To The Ball Game". The tradition actually got started when Caray was announcing for the Chicago White Sox. Caray made a habit of privately singing along with the song while long-time Comiskey Park organist Nancy Faust was playing it for the public. One afternoon, Caray was singing to himself when WMAQ radio producer/broadcaster Jay Scott decided to open the booth mics without letting Caray know that he was doing this and a tradition was born. One that Harry continued throughout his professional career.

He took it with him when he moved from the White Sox to the Cubs in 1981. After Harry died in 1998 (two days before the death of my father), the Cubs began a practice of inviting guest celebrities, local and national, to lead the singing Caray-style. The use of "guest conductors" continues to this day.
